ABOUT THE ROLE:

Position: Learning Coach 

Position Summary: The Learning Coach plays a vital role in Elev8 Baltimore’s Out-of-School Time (OST) programs by creating safe, engaging, and structured learning environments for youth. This position combines direct student engagement with program facilitation, helping young people build academic, social, and emotional skills beyond the school day. As a core member of the program team, the Learning Coach sets the tone for student success by fostering strong relationships, encouraging active participation, and modeling Elev8 Baltimore’s organizational values. This is an opportunity for dynamic, motivated individuals to make a meaningful impact on the lives of Baltimore City youth. 

Reports to: Extended Learning Coordinator 

Seasonal Schedule (Timeframes subject to change; Daily hours vary by school site) 
Fall: September through December (15-20 hours per week) 
Winter/Spring: January through May (15-20 hours per week) 
 
Job Classification: Part-time, Non-Exempt, Temporary 

Status: Part-time

Compensation: $20.00 per hour 

Responsibilities: 

· Plan and facilitate academic enrichment activities for assigned students, focusing on skill-building, engagement, and support beyond the school day. 
·Plan and conduct enrichment activities (recreational, arts, cultural, or developmental) for assigned student groups to promote holistic growth. 
· Implement Youth Program Quality Intervention (YPQI) engagement strategies learned through provided training to strengthen student participation and outcomes. 
· Collaborate with staff, families, and community partners to create supportive, structured environments for students. 
·  Serve as a facilitator of after-school and summer program activities and special events, including chaperoning field trips. 
· Assist with classroom setup and breakdown, organizing instructional materials and equipment as needed. 
· Assist with distribution and cleanup of meals (snacks, dinner, and summer lunch). 
· Complete required documentation, including attendance rosters and student progress notes. 
·Attend all mandatory staff meetings, professional development sessions, and planning meetings to support program quality and staff growth. 
·Perform other duties as assigned to ensure the success of the program
